We are seeking an experienced Data Integration Engineer with strong hands-on expertise in Informatica PowerCenter or Informatica Intelligent Cloud Services (IICS), and ideally some experience working with AWS cloud-based data services. You will be responsible for designing, building, and maintaining data pipelines to support enterprise data warehousing, analytics, and reporting solutions.
Key Responsibilities- Design and develop ETL/ELT workflows using Informatica to support data integration and transformation needs.
- Work with large-scale structured and unstructured data from various sources including on-premise and cloud platforms.
- Develop and optimize data pipelines and data integration processes between on-premises systems and AWS cloud services such as S3, Redshift, RDS, Glue, and Lambda.
- Collaborate with Data Architects, Data Analysts, and BI developers to understand data requirements and deliver solutions.
- Ensure data quality, consistency, and governance across platforms.
- Implement error handling, logging, and performance tuning for ETL jobs.
- Support production deployments, monitoring, and incident resolution.
- 5+ years of experience in ETL development using Informatica (PowerCenter and/or IICS).
- Strong understanding of data warehousing concepts, data modelling (dimensional/star schema), and data integration patterns.
- Hands-on experience with SQL and relational databases (e.g., Oracle, SQL Server, PostgreSQL).
- Familiarity with AWS data services such as S3, Redshift, Glue, EMR, Lambda, or RDS.
- Knowledge of scripting languages (e.g., Python, Shell) for automation and orchestration.
- Experience working in Agile environments and using tools such as JIRA, Git, or CI/CD pipelines.
- Excellent problem-solving, debugging, and performance tuning skills.
- AWS Certification (e.g., AWS Certified Data Analytics – Specialty, AWS Certified Solutions Architect – Associate).
- Experience migrating on-premise ETL processes to the cloud.
- Knowledge of Informatica Cloud integrations with AWS.
- Exposure to DevOps and Infrastructure as Code (e.g., Terraform, CloudFormation).
